AOL to Launch Online Casino
One of the internet’s oldest and most well known service providers is intending to develop its own online casino site. In a press statement last week, AOL announced plans to join the online casino industry by establishing its own online casino site specializing in blackjack. The site will act as a portal to enable casino fans to access a range of blackjack resources and will be designed by Game Show Network.

Billed to go live at the end of April, the online casino site will feature free blackjack games, tips and advice from the professionals and ongoing information and coverage on the World Series of Blackjack scheduled to take place this summer. Ralph Riveral, AOL’s general manager, has stated that online casino products such as poker and blackjack have become popular amongst AOL’s mainstream audience, not just among online casino fans. While the company’s partnership with Harrah’s Entertainment is well known for its creation of the World Series of Poker website, AOL is also focussing individual attention on other gaming products. In particular, a new project to incorporate online and interactive TV games is already creating interest among gaming fans.

The number of internet and gaming firms moving into the online casino industry continues to grow. Several British media companies have recently purchased significant shareholdings in online casino firms in an attempt to solidify interests. The creation of strategic partnerships between firms is predicted to be amongst the key trends taking place in the industry this year, along with cross-selling and diversification.
